(PLAB) on Wednesday reported fiscal third-quarter profit of $28.9 million. On a per-share basis, the Brookfield, Connecticut-based company said it had net income of 49 cents. Earnings, adjusted for non-recurring costs, were 50 cents per share.
The results beat Wall Street expectations. The average estimate of three analysts surveyed by Zacks Investment Research was for earnings of 40 cents per share. The electronics imaging company posted revenue of $216 million in the period, also surpassing Street forecasts.
Three analysts surveyed by Zacks expected $208.7 million. For the current quarter ending in October, Photronics expects its per-share earnings to range from 40 cents to 56 cents. The company said it expects revenue in the range of $207 million to $227 million for the fiscal fourth quarter.
